  23. Determine the Value of the following rating of resistors:

    a) 100F
    b) 190M
    c) 562J
    d) 333K
    e) 471G
    • First 2 digits - significant
    • Third digit - number of zeros
    • Tolerances:
    • F = +- 1%
    • G = +- 2%
    • J = +- 5%
    • K = +- 10%
    • M = +- 20%

    • a. 10 ohm +- 1%
    • b. 19 ohm +- 20%
    • c. 5600 ohm +- 5%
    • d. 33000 ohm +- 10%
    • e. 470 ohm +- 2%
